     I recommend the same of installing last kamailio version, 1.1.1
    is really really old.

    However, I don't understand why you need to edit the binary with
    GHex. You can run kamailio (or older versions that had openser
    name) as many times as you want with different configuration
    files, just be sure you don't conflict on listening sockets.

    For example:

    /usr/local/sbin/kamailio -f /usr/local/etc/kamailio/kamailio1.cfg
    /usr/local/sbin/kamailio -f /usr/local/etc/kamailio/kamailio2.cfg
